> On Wed, Apr 6, 2011 at 1:37 PM, Zaher Dirkey <parmaja at gmail.com> wrote:
> > Can i do that?
> > type
> >   IIntf3 = interface(IIntf11, IIntf2)
> > ....
> >   end;
> >
> > Thanks in advance.
> > --
> > Zaher Dirkey
> >
>
> For Corba interfaces, yes. Not for COM interfaces.
> http://www.freepascal.org/docs-html/ref/refse39.html
>
>
I added {$INTERFACES CORBA} but same error ~Fatal: Syntax error, ")"
expected but "," found~ in the line ~IIntf3 = interface(IIntf11, IIntf2)~
